
FL Congressional District 2
Austin Rogers statements on crypto
Austin Rogers completed the Stand With Crypto Questionnaire and expressed strong support for clear legislative and regulatory frameworks to foster digital asset innovation and maintain U.S. leadership. He advocates for self-custody rights, clear definitions for digital assets as securities or commodities, and supports specific bills like the Clarity Act and the Blockchain Regulatory Certainty Act, while opposing central bank digital currencies.
Evan Power statements on crypto
Evan Power completed the Stand With Crypto Questionnaire and expressed strong support for establishing clear legislative frameworks for digital assets, advocating for the "Clarity Act" to provide certainty for the industry. Power believes Congress should create pathways for digital asset businesses, protect the right to self-custody, and end regulatory de-banking of lawful crypto users. He also supports updating market structure laws for digital asset trading venues and believes the federal government should provide stable regulation to foster blockchain innovation.
